你是否曾在使用英飞凌芯片时遇到模型格式不兼容的问题?面对不同开发环境频繁转换文件格式是否感到困扰?
掌握正确的模型转换方法不仅能提升工作效率,还能确保仿真结果的准确性。
为什么需要进行模型格式转换?
英飞凌提供的芯片模型通常包含多种类型的数据:
– SPICE仿真模型
– IBIS输入输出缓冲模型
– 3D封装结构数据
这些模型可能需要适配到不同的开发平台,如Cadence、Altium Designer或LTspice等工具。每种软件对模型格式的要求存在差异,因此了解基本的转换逻辑至关重要。
常见转换需求场景
| 场景 | 原始格式 | 目标格式 |
|---|---|---|
| 从仿真到布板 | .cir |
.lib |
| 系统级验证 | .ibs |
.spd |
| 多物理场分析 | .stl |
.step |
如何高效完成模型转换?
第一步是确认所需模型的功能定义。例如,滤波电容用于平滑电压波动的设计中,应优先关注其对应的SPICE子电路描述部分。接着根据目标软件的支持情况选择合适的转换方式:1. 使用官方提供的转换工具(如ModelSelect)2. 利用通用EDA软件内置的导入功能3. 通过中间格式(如EDIF)过渡处理> 上海工品建议在转换过程中始终保留原始模型文档,并仔细核对关键参数映射关系。
常见问题及应对策略
当出现模型加载失败的情况时,可检查以下方面:- 文件编码是否符合目标软件要求- 是否缺少必要的库依赖项- 引脚定义是否存在冲突对于复杂系统设计,可能需要分阶段测试各模块模型的兼容性。如果发现仿真结果偏差较大,通常建议重新导出并校验模型转换过程中的映射规则。
